Denna video kommer att anv\u00e4nda RIT01M-reststr\u00f6mtransducern som exempel f\u00f6r att i detalj f\u00f6rklara standardanslutningsmetoden f\u00f6r dess 4-PIN-crimpede terminaler.<\/p>\n<p>Utrustningen som anv\u00e4nds i detta test inkluderar:<\/p>\n<ul>\n<li>En programmerbar DC-standardstr\u00f6mf\u00f6rs\u00f6rjning utvecklad och tillverkad av Hangzhi f\u00f6r att testa utsignalen.<\/li>\n<li>En h\u00f6gprecision 6\u00bd-siffrig digital multimeter m\u00e4ter transducerns utg\u00e5ng.<\/li>\n<li>Och en transduktoreffektf\u00f6rs\u00f6rjning som levererar \u00b115V str\u00f6m.<\/li>\n<li>En RIT 01M-residualstr\u00f6mstransducer.<\/li>\n<\/ul>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<section class=\"elementor-section elementor-inner-section elementor-element elementor-element-5f35f66 elementor-section-boxed elementor-section-height-default elementor-section-height-default\" data-id=\"5f35f66\" data-element_type=\"section\" data-e-type=\"section\">\n\t\t\t\t\t\t<div class=\"elementor-container elementor-column-gap-default\">\n\t\t\t\t\t<div class=\"elementor-column elementor-col-50 elementor-inner-column elementor-element elementor-element-4e1ff9c\" data-id=\"4e1ff9c\" data-element_type=\"column\" data-e-type=\"column\" data-settings=\"{&quot;background_background&quot;:&quot;classic&quot;}\">\n\t\t\t<div class=\"elementor-widget-wrap elementor-element-populated\">\n\t\t\t\t\t\t<div class=\"elementor-element elementor-element-4e3bbb4 elementor-widget__width-initial elementor-widget elementor-widget-heading\" data-id=\"4e3bbb4\" data-element_type=\"widget\" data-e-type=\"widget\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h2 class=\"elementor-heading-title elementor-size-default\">Hur kopplar jag RIT01M str\u00f6msensorn?<\/h2>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/div>\n\t\t\t\t<div class=\"elementor-column elementor-col-50 elementor-inner-column elementor-element elementor-element-8066070\" data-id=\"8066070\" data-element_type=\"column\" data-e-type=\"column\">\n\t\t\t<div class=\"elementor-widget-wrap\">\n\t\t\t\t\t\t\t<\/div>\n\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t<\/section>\n\t\t\t\t<div class=\"elementor-element elementor-element-d1b303e elementor-widget elementor-widget-text-editor\" data-id=\"d1b303e\" data-element_type=\"widget\" data-e-type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>L\u00e5t oss ta en titt p\u00e5 utseendet av RIT 01M. Den har monteringsh\u00e5l p\u00e5 b\u00e5da sidor f\u00f6r enkel installation i olika scenarier. I mitten finns ett str\u00f6mgenomg\u00e5ngsh\u00e5l f\u00f6r inf\u00f6rande av prim\u00e4rstr\u00f6m. Panelen \u00e4r utrustad med ett 4-PIN-crimpade terminalgr\u00e4nssnitt, en k\u00f6rindikatorlampa, en nolljusteringsresistor och en utg\u00e5ngsproportionaljusteringsresistor. Dessa tv\u00e5 resistorer kr\u00e4ver vanligtvis ingen bearbetning.<\/p><h3>Terminaldefinitioner p\u00e5 omvandlaren.<\/h3><p>Fr\u00e5n toppen till botten<\/p><ul><li>\"+\" ansluts till +15V-str\u00f6mf\u00f6rs\u00f6rjningen.<\/li><li>\"-\" \u00e4r ansluten till -15V-str\u00f6mf\u00f6rs\u00f6rjningen.<\/li><li>UT: signalutg\u00e5ngsterminal<\/li><li>GND: str\u00f6mjord (0V), som ocks\u00e5 \u00e4r den gemensamma signalutg\u00e5ngsterminalen.<\/li><\/ul><p>Vid kablagning, kontrollera noga terminalm\u00e4rkningarna p\u00e5 givaren f\u00f6r att s\u00e4kerst\u00e4lla korrekt kablagning. Detta \u00e4r grundl\u00e4ggande f\u00f6r att s\u00e4kerst\u00e4lla att givaren fungerar korrekt. Detta \u00e4r en f\u00f6rinstallerad 4-stifts crimp-terminalkontakt enligt terminaldefinitionerna. Kabeln motsvarar +15V-matningsledningen, -15V-matningsledningen, jordledningen, den sekund\u00e4ra utg\u00e5ngsterminalen fr\u00e5n OUT och den gemensamma utg\u00e5ngsterminalen fr\u00e5n G.<\/p><p>Sedan s\u00e4tter vi in den i transducerns 4-poliga krimpade terminalkontakt, vilket avslutar ledningsarbetet p\u00e5 transducerpanelens sida.<\/p><p>Den andra \u00e4nden av kabeln ansluts till str\u00f6mf\u00f6rs\u00f6rjningens \"+\"-, \"-\"- och \"jord\"-terminaler. Observera att RIT 01M-residualstr\u00f6mtransducern avger en sp\u00e4nningssignal; d\u00e4rf\u00f6r ska de positiva och negativa sekund\u00e4ra utg\u00e5ngarna anslutas till de positiva respektive negativa sp\u00e4nningsutg\u00e5ngarna p\u00e5 en 6\u00bd-siffrig multimeter. Detta avslutar alla ledningssteg. Sl\u00e5 p\u00e5 str\u00f6mtransducern under tomg\u00e5ng. Ett normalt p\u00e5slag b\u00f6r resultera i ett fast gr\u00f6nt indikatorljus.
